Hydrolysis of 1,1,3,3-Tetrakis(dimethylamino)-1λ5, 3λ5 -diphospheteHydrolysis of 1,1,3,3-Tetrakis(dimethylamino)-1λ5, 3λ5 -diphosphet (2) yields in the first step Bis(dimethylamino)phosphorylmethyliden-methyl-bis(dimethylamino)phosphorane (5). In the second step Bis(dimethylamino)phosphoryl-methyl(dimethylamino)phosphosphonylmethylen (6) is the main product of hydrolysis. In addition small amounts of methylphosphonic-bis(dimethylamide) (7) are formed. Properties, nmr and mass spectra of 5 and 6 are described, their mechanism of formation is discussed.
